Travelers will appreciate the convenience of the ticket office at Pitsea station, open from the early hours of the morning until late at night. From Monday to Friday, it operates from 05:15 to 20:00, Saturday from 06:15 to 20:00, and Sunday between 06:45 to 20:45. Not to worry if you prefer purchasing your tickets on the go—ticket machines are available for easy access, along with facilities to collect tickets bought online.
Pitsea Station boasts step-free access throughout, including lift access to all platforms and ticket barriers with accessible ticket machines. The station is well-equipped for travelers who need additional support, featuring induction loops and ramps for train access. The staff is available to assist from Monday to Friday, from 06:00 to 21:00, ensuring a smooth and comfortable journey for all passengers.
Enhancing your comfort are facilities such as CCTV, seating areas, and accessible toilets situated in the booking hall, which can be accessed with a RADAR key.

Rainham (Essex) station prioritizes passenger comfort with a number of useful facilities. Ticketing is seamless with electronic ticket machines and the added convenience of collecting pre-purchased tickets. The ticket office operates on weekdays from 06:15 to 09:50—ideal for early morning travelers. Accessibility is a notable feature; the station proudly offers step-free access across its premises. There are five accessible parking spaces to ensure easy access for those with mobility challenges. Induction loops and accessible toilets located on Platform 2 cater to the needs of all travelers.
Though lacking a waiting room or onsite shops, Platform 2 features refreshment facilities for that caffeine kick pre-journey, and free public Wi-Fi keeps you connected on the go. While there's no ATM machine, secure bicycle storage with CCTV protection is available for cyclists. Safety is prioritized with CCTV monitoring throughout the site.
